Louisiana State University basketball star, Angel Reese has said that viral n*de photos of her on the internet are fake and AI-generated.

The SEC Player of the Year is taking an upsetting situation and making the best of it, all while making it clear she’d never pose nude on social media.

The 21-year-old college basketball star addressed the controversy on social media on Tuesday, writing point blank, “Creating fake AI pictures of me is crazy and weird AF! Like I know im fine & seem to have an appeal to some but im literally 21 and yall doing this bs when I would neverrrrrr”

On championships, Reese is averaging 19 points and 13 rebounds, and is preparing for March Madness. Her LSU squad is a three-seed in the Albany bracket, where they’re hoping to run the table. The Tigers’ first game is against 14-seeded Rice, a contest they’re heavily favored to win.

Louisiana State Univ. is looking to go back-to-back after winning a Natty last year under legendary coach Kim Mulkey. Angel was named the NCAA Tournament’s Most Outstanding Player.
